08JunPopular Koay Teow Soup, Chang Jiang Sec 17

I have heard about this stall located below the stretch of flat in Section 17 PJ long ago and I decided to pay my first visit last weekend. This stall is famous for their steamed chicken with Koay Teow noodle soup but you can also have a choice for fish paste or pork to go with your noodle. I don’t particular craze for this type of food but a recent conversation with my wife which is extremely crazy for Penang style Koay Teow soup, made me recall this stall.
